2019 57th Record Academy Awards Special Category Special Award!

The Beethoven Cycles, which Joe Hisaishi has been working on since 2016, has attracted attention for its unprecedented modern approach. Beethoven, analyzed from a composer's point of view, is full of momentum and vitality.
In 2019, together with Joe Hisaishi, the "Nagano Chamber Orchestra", a collection of young top Japanese players, will make a new start as an orchestra that will spread its message to the world under the new name "Future Orchestra Classics".
